Loose Gutter Repair in Longmont, CO

Loose gutter repair services address issues related to gutters that have become detached, sagging, or misaligned on a property. This type of repair typically involves reattaching loose sections, tightening brackets, or replacing damaged hardware to ensure gutters function properly. Projects may include fixing gutters that have come away from the roofline due to weather, age, or improper installation, as well as addressing sagging or uneven sections that can cause water to overflow or damage the property’s foundation. Property owners should understand the extent of damage or looseness before requesting repairs, and it’s helpful to know whether the issue involves a specific section or the entire gutter system.

Before requesting loose gutter repair, homeowners usually want to know what the repair process entails and whether any additional work might be necessary, such as cleaning or replacing sections. It’s also common to inquire about the causes of the problem, like heavy rainfall or debris buildup, and to understand how the repair will restore the gutter system’s integrity. Properly functioning gutters are essential for directing water away from the foundation and preventing water damage, so property owners often seek to address loose or sagging gutters promptly to maintain the property’s overall condition.

Project Types

Common Loose Gutter Repair Jobs

Loose gutter repair - restores gutters to proper function and prevents water damage.

Gutter strap replacement - secures gutters firmly to the roofline for stability.

Fastener tightening - addresses sagging gutters caused by loose or missing fasteners.

Bracket and hanger repair - fixes or replaces damaged supports to maintain gutter alignment.

Seam and joint sealing - prevents leaks at gutter connections and corners.

Debris removal and cleaning - clears blockages that can cause overflowing and damage.

Loose Gutter Repair Questions

What causes gutters to become loose? Gutters can become loose due to weather exposure, heavy debris buildup, or age-related wear and tear.

How can loose gutters affect a property? They may lead to water damage, foundation issues, or landscape erosion if not repaired promptly.

What signs indicate a gutter needs repair? Visible sagging, detachment from the fascia, or overflowing during rain are common signs.

Is loose gutter repair a DIY project? Repairing gutters often requires specific tools and expertise for proper and safe installation.
